加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.cn/)- 事件网格、研发安全、负载均衡、云连接、大数据!
当前位置: 首页 > 站长百科 > 正文

零基础跃迁精通:数据库高效构建与运维全攻略,role:assistant

发布时间:2026-02-10 15:28:13 所属栏目:站长百科 来源:DaWei
导读:  对于零基础的学习者来说,数据库的构建与运维看似复杂且难以入门。但实际上,只要掌握正确的学习路径和工具,就能逐步实现从零到精通的跃迁。  构建数据库的第一步是理解其核心概念。数据库是一个用于存储、管

  对于零基础的学习者来说,数据库的构建与运维看似复杂且难以入门。但实际上,只要掌握正确的学习路径和工具,就能逐步实现从零到精通的跃迁。


  构建数据库的第一步是理解其核心概念。数据库是一个用于存储、管理和检索数据的系统,常见的类型包括关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B)。选择适合项目需求的数据库类型是关键。


  在实际操作中,安装和配置数据库环境是必不可少的步骤。以MySQL为例,可以通过官方文档或包管理器快速安装。配置文件中的参数设置直接影响性能,例如最大连接数、缓存大小等,需要根据实际应用场景进行调整。


  数据建模是数据库高效构建的重要环节。通过ER图(实体-关系图)来规划表结构,明确字段之间的关系,可以有效避免数据冗余和不一致问题。合理设计主键、外键以及索引,能够显著提升查询效率。


  运维方面,定期备份和监控是保障数据安全的核心手段。使用自动化脚本或工具(如cron、pgBackRest)进行定时备份,防止数据丢失。同时,监控数据库的运行状态,如CPU、内存、磁盘使用情况,有助于及时发现并解决问题。


本图基于AI算法,仅供参考

  性能优化是数据库运维中的重点。通过分析慢查询日志,优化SQL语句,添加合适的索引,可以大幅提升响应速度。合理利用缓存机制,如Redis,也能有效减轻数据库压力。


  随着技术的不断进步,云数据库服务(如AWS RDS、阿里云PolarDB)为开发者提供了更便捷的解决方案。这些服务不仅简化了部署流程,还提供了自动扩展、高可用性等高级功能,降低了运维复杂度。


  持续学习和实践是掌握数据库技能的关键。通过参与开源项目、阅读官方文档、参加技术社区交流,可以不断积累经验,提升实战能力。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章